Under minimal supervision, the Cost Accountant will be responsible for completing cost accounting activities for the Wine & Spirits Division entities to maintain a complete and accurate general ledger in accordance with U.S. GAAP. This individual will also function as a key support role to business partners, handling all activities related to the global accounting function: close procedures, preparation, review and analysis, maintaining a strong control environment, and other activities necessary to support consolidated financial statements.
The Cost Accountant must exhibit agility as we operate in a fast‑paced environment.
- Primary functions of cost accounting include:
- Ensure accurate and timely preparation of cost accounting reports, including cost of goods sold (COGS), inventory valuation, and variance analysis.
- Analyze costs of inventory, COGS, identify trends, and provide insights.
- Collaborate with cross‑functional teams, including operations, supply chain, and finance, to drive cost efficiencies and support strategic initiatives.
- Responsible for preparation of monthly accounting close procedures to ensure compliance with U.S. GAAP and internal controls, and the accuracy of financial statements. Specific month‑end close activities include:
- Collaboration with business partners outside of accounting to accumulate support needed for journal entry preparation.
- Preparation of journal entries for operating companies, as well as consolidation and elimination entries.
- Review of trial balances and monthly and quarterly trends; perform additional review as needed to support the close.
- Analysis and review of operating company financial statements, both foreign and domestic.
- Preparation of high‑quality balance sheet account reconciliations.
- Preparation and presentation of quarterly analysis deliverables.
- Support a sustainable and efficient close and reporting process with a continuous improvement mindset.
- Preparation of quarterly external reporting deliverables and support of internal and external audit requirements.
